



































































































At a Palm Jumeirah developer launch in Dubai, focus on project fundamentals. Ask about the official completion date and construction timelines, as Dubai off-plan projects can face delays. Inquire about unit specifications, including finishes and included appliances, to ensure luxury standards. Clarify title deed transfer procedures and escrow account details, mandated by Dubai's real estate regulations. These questions help verify project legitimacy and safeguard your investment in the UAE's dynamic property market.
In Abu Dhabi city center, the primary gas utility is piped natural gas (PNG) supplied by ADNOC Distribution to many older and newer buildings, offering a continuous, metered service. On Al Reem Island, as a newer master-planned community, infrastructure varies by tower. While some buildings may have PNG, many rely on centralized LPG systems or individual cylinder deliveries. The key difference is predictability; city center residents often have a standardized, direct-billed utility, while Reem Island occupants must confirm their building's specific setup, which can involve dealing with building management or third-party suppliers.

For UAE expats buying developer property in Business Bay, Dubai, start with verifying the developer's RERA registration and project approval. Next, engage a local real estate lawyer to review the Sales Purchase Agreement, ensuring payment plans and completion dates are clear. Then, confirm the developer uses a RERA-mandated Escrow Account for your payments. Finally, register the contract with the Dubai Land Department to formalize ownership. These steps are critical to safeguard your investment in Dubai's fast-paced market.
New apartments from Karama's reputable developers typically include a modern, semi-furnished package. This often features built-in wardrobes in bedrooms, high-quality kitchen cabinets with appliances like a hob, hood, and oven, and air conditioning throughout. Tiled flooring is standard, and bathrooms come fully fitted. Many buildings also offer shared amenities such as a swimming pool, gym, and secure underground parking. For families and professionals in Dubai, these features provide a convenient move-in ready solution in this centrally located, established community.
